§ 115C‑318.  Liability insurance for nonteaching public school personnel.

The State Board of Education shall provide funds for liability insurance for nonteaching public school personnel to the extent that such personnel's salaries are funded by the State. The insurance shall cover claims made for injury liability and property damage liability on account of an act done or an omission made in the course of the employee's duties. As provided by law or the rules and policies of the State Board of Education or the local school administrative unit, the State Board of Education shall comply with the State's laws in securing the insurance and shall provide it at the earliest possible date for the 1982‑83 school year. Nothing in this section shall prevent the State Board from furnishing the same liability insurance protection for nonteaching public school personnel not supported by State funds, provided that the cost of the protection shall be funded from the same source that supports the salaries of these employees. (1981 (Reg. Sess., 1982), c. 1399, s. 3; 1993, c. 522, s. 4; 1995, c. 450, s. 22.)
